The ingredients needed to make Kashmiri Pulao:
  1. Prepare For Pulao
  2. Get 1 cup soaked basmati rice
  3. Take to taste Salt
  4. Prepare 1/2 Lemon juice
  5. Get 1/2 oil
  6. Make ready 1/2 teaspoon jeera
  7. Take 1-2 Tej patta
  8. Take 5-6 Cloves and black pepper
  9. Make ready 2-3 small Cardamom
  10. Make ready 4-5 strands Saffron
  11. Get 7-8 Kaju and badam
  12. Get For sabji
  13. Take 2 medium size Onion
  14. Get 1 medium size tomato
  15. Get 1 teaspoon ginger, garlic and green chilli paste
  16. Take 1 teaspoon dry coconut
  17. Get 150 gram boiled potato
  18. Make ready 50 gram boiled mutter
  19. Make ready 1/2 cup green capsicum
  20. Make ready as needed Oil
  21. Take 1 teaspoon Red chilli powder
  22. Make ready 1 teaspoon dhaniya jeera and garam masala powder
  23. Prepare 1/2 teaspoon haldi powder
  24. Get to taste Salt
  25. Make ready 1/2 cup water
  26. Make ready Garnish with coriander
  27. Prepare 1/2 cup fruit ( chikoo, grapes, pomegranate, banana )

Kashmiri pulao is a very popular Kashmiri rice dish prepared with dry fruits, nuts and fresh fruits. It is an exotic dish perfect for get togethers and small parties. It is one of the simplest pulao recipe. Kashmiri pulao is unlike the normal pulao recipes will not be spicy.

Steps to make Kashmiri Pulao:
  1. Add oil and fry nuts till lightly golden. Add raisins and fry. Set this aside.
  2. To the same pan, add little more ghee and fry sliced onions till golden.
  3. Add soaked and drained rice, salt and 1/2 tbsp. Oil. Fry for about 3 to 4 minutes. Roasting of rice in oil along with spices gives a good aroma to the kashmiri pulao.
  4. Pour saffron milk and water. Stir and cook the rice until done. Lower the flame and cook for 3 to 5 minutes. Switch off the stove. Do not let the cooker whistle. If using normal rice, let it whistle once.
  5. Take another pan add onion and tomato paste. Cook for 10 min. Cover with lid. Add dry masala.
  6. After 10 min add boiled potato, capsicum and boiled mutter. Mix it well. Cook for 5 min. Turn off gas.
  7. Transfer the rice to a serving bowl.
  8. Layer of sabji and rice. Add fruits. Mix it well.
  9. Add roasted dry fruits and onion
  10. Garnish with coriander
